Optimizing Reimbursement: Billing Insights for Urologists in the Field of Urology

In the ever-evolving field of urology, optimizing reimbursement is crucial for the financial health of urology practices. This blog post explores key billing insights that can help urologists navigate the complexities of reimbursement and enhance their revenue streams.

Understanding Urology Billing Challenges

  1. Coding Accuracy: The importance of accurate coding in urology procedures.
  2. Documentation Requirements: Ensuring comprehensive documentation to support billing claims.
  3. Navigating Medicare and Private Payers: Understanding the specific requirements of major payers in urology.

Best Practices for Urology Billing Optimization

  1. Streamlining the Billing Process: Implementing efficient billing workflows to minimize errors.
  2. Staff Training and Education: Investing in ongoing education for billing staff on coding updates and compliance.
  3. Utilizing Technology Solutions: Exploring electronic health record (EHR) systems and billing software to streamline processes.

Common Billing Pitfalls to Avoid

  1. Incomplete Documentation: Addressing the risks associated with insufficient patient records.
  2. Failure to Stay Updated with Coding Changes: The impact of outdated coding on reimbursement.
  3. Ignoring Denials and Appeals: Strategies for managing denied claims and the importance of appeals.

Maximizing Reimbursement Opportunities

  1. Proper Use of Modifiers: Understanding when and how to use modifiers for accurate reimbursement.
  2. Negotiating Payer Contracts: Tips for negotiating favorable reimbursement rates with payers.
  3. Implementing Telehealth Services: Leveraging telehealth to expand service reach and increase reimbursement opportunities.

Staying Compliant with Regulations

  1. Compliance with HIPAA Regulations: The importance of safeguarding patient information in billing processes.
  2. Auditing and Monitoring: Establishing regular audits to ensure compliance and identify areas for improvement.

Conclusion

Optimizing reimbursement for urology practices involves a combination of accurate coding, efficient workflows, and staying abreast of regulatory changes. By implementing best practices and avoiding common pitfalls, urologists can enhance their financial well-being and provide high-quality care to their patients.
